How similar are IVV and RSPT?
iShares Core S&P 500 ETF (IVV, by iShares) holds 503 positions;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ight Technology ETF (RSPT, by Invesco) holds 73. They have 73 holdings in common, and by portfolio weight the two funds are 16.3% identical. In practical terms the pair is lightly overlapping, with most of each portfolio distinct.

Sector Breakdown
| Sector | IVV | RSPT |
|---|---|---|
| Information Technology | 32.6% | 98.7% |
| Financials | 12.6% | 0.0% |
| Communication Services | 10.5% | 1.2% |
| Consumer Discretionary | 9.8% | 0.0% |
| Health Care | 9.4% | 0.0% |
| Other Sectors | 24.8% | 0.0% |
Share of each fund's portfolio weight by GICS-style sector, compiled from issuer fund data and our own classification of the holdings, not the issuers' published sector charts.
